Why do we need a transformer in a power system?
In general, in the power system, traditional transformers are used to step up/step down the voltage. But these transformers do not have the ability to compensate for voltage sag and swell, reactive power, fault isolation, and so on. But with SST we will be able to overcome these drawbacks.

How to control power flow in a high-frequency transformer?
Another simple method is the phase shift control method. In this method, a phase shift is applied between the primary and secondary voltages of the high-frequency transformer (HFT). This provides a simple method to control the magnitude and direction of power flow in the system.

Should solar energy be combined with storage technologies?
Sometimes two is better than one. Coupling solar energy and storage technologies is one such case. The reason: Solar energy is not always produced at the time energy is needed most. Peak power usage often occurs on summer afternoons and evenings, when solar energy generation is falling.
Why is PV technology integrated with energy storage important?
PV technology integrated with energy storage is necessary to store excess PV power generated for later use when required. Energy storage can help power networks withstand peaks in demand allowing transmission and distribution grids to operate efficiently.
